
RABAT, April 4. /The Times of Russia/. Iranian President Masoud Pezeshkian has asked the world to judge which of the two sides, Tehran or Washington, actually favors talks toward resolving the conflict raging in the Persian Gulf. “Just as I was addressing the American people [in an open letter], the head of our Strategic Council on Foreign Policy was targeted in an assassination attempt, leading to the martyrdom of his innocent wife,” the Iranian leader wrote in a post on X.
